    ECL 2024 announces BookMyShow as exclusive ticket partner

    Mumbai: Tickets for the inaugural Entertainers Cricket League (ECL) 2024, an influencer-driven T10 cricket league, are now available on BookMyShow, the exclusive ticketing partner. The league starts on 13 September 2024 at the Indira Gandhi Indoor Stadium, New Delhi. ECL season one will feature 19 matches over 10 days, with six franchises and 96 content creators from various industries, including tech, finance, infotainment, gaming, fashion, and lifestyle.

    Cricket and entertainment fans can purchase their tickets starting today, with prices ranging from ₹150 for general entry to ₹10,000 for premium seats, offering a variety of options to suit every fan.     Day one on 13 September, has two group-stage double-headers lined up, beginning with Abhishek Malhan aka Fukra Insaan led Bangalore Bashers taking on Elvish Yadav led Haryanvi Hunters. The second match will feature Munawar Faruqui-led Mumbai Disruptors against the Anurag Dwivedi-led Lucknow Lions.

    The first game begins at 5.30 pm Indian Standard Time (IST), while the second starts at 8.30 pm IST.

    Following the group stages, the knockout games begin on 20 September 2024. Qualifier one will be played at 5:30 pm, with the eliminator match scheduled for 8:30 pm on the same day.

    Qualifier two is set for 21 September 2024, at 8:30 pm while the grand finale of ECL season one will take place on Sunday, 22 September 2024, at 8:30 pm IST.

    Legends League Cricket appointed BookMyShow as exclusive ticketing partner

    Mumbai: Legends League Cricket has announced that India’s leading entertainment destination, BookMyShow, has been appointed as the exclusive ticketing partner for its upcoming season.

    The next season will be played between 16 September – 5 October 2022, and tickets will be available exclusively on BookMyShow. Fans can also get their tickets for the special matches, which will be played on 16 September, 2022, between Indian Maharajas and World Giants, on BookMyShow.     The Legends League Cricket will be a four-team tournament and a 16-match affair. The league will start on 16 September at the Eden Gardens in Kolkata and will be hosted in five different cities, including Lucknow, New Delhi, Cuttack, and Jodhpur.
